Research in obtaining the darkest shade of black color on the aluminum surface is challenging but worthwhile. The process starts with forming an anodic film on aluminum, then obtaining the darkest shade of black color using an electrolytic method. The coloring impact factors such as electrolyte concentration, bath temperature, voltage, and time duration were all investigated in the research. The conditions to obtain the darkest shade of black coating with approximately 0.03 of minimum visible light reflectivity and 17.6 of minimum L-value include a mixed solution of 35 g/L copper sulfate, 10 g/L sulfuric acid and 2 g/L sodium sulfate, at a temperature of 40 degrees C with a voltage of 30 V and a duration of 50 min. The research has found that the bath temperature is the most important coloring factor. The film has a stronger anti-corrosion ability when colored at a low bath temperature. (C) 2008 Elsevier B.V.
